1. Metallurgical Composition & Standardisation
| Material Grade | Silver Content | Hardness (Vickers) | Verification Method |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sterling Silver | 92.5% Pure | ~75-100 Hv | UK Assay Office Hallmark |
| Fine Silver | 99.9% Pure | ~25-30 Hv | Bullion Assay |
| Silver Plate | <1% Pure | Variable | Acid Test/Mechanical Inspection |
Analysis: This bracelet is composed of 925 Sterling Silver, the international benchmark for high-quality jewellery. The inclusion of 7.5% copper alloy is technically necessary to increase the Vickers hardness, ensuring the links resist deformation. Unlike unhallmarked items, this piece has been independently verified for its metal purity.

3. Hallmarking & Compliance Data
| Marking Type | Description | Purpose | Requirement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standard Mark | 925 inside a Scales or Oval | Purity Guarantee | Mandatory (>7.78g) |
| Sponsor's Mark | Unique Initial Stamp | Identifies Manufacturer | Mandatory |
| Assay Office Mark | Anchor/Leopard/Rose/Castle | Origin Verification | Mandatory |
Analysis: For silver jewellery weighing over 7.78g, a UK hallmark is a legal requirement. This 19g bracelet is fully compliant, featuring a deep-struck hallmark that confirms it has passed through an official UK Assay Office. This provides an immutable layer of consumer protection and asset verification.

Metallurgy & Authenticity
1. What is the specific chemical composition of this 925 silver?
The "925" standard refers to a fineness of 925 parts per thousand. Chemically, this bracelet consists of 92.5% pure silver and 7.5% alloy, typically copper. This ratio is the metallurgical "sweet spot" that allows the silver to retain its brilliant white lustre while gaining the structural strength necessary for link-based jewellery construction.
2. Why is a full hallmark better than a simple '925' stamp?
A '925' stamp can be applied by any manufacturer and is not proof of purity. A full UK hallmark, however, is an independent guarantee applied by an Assay Office after scientific testing. For an item like the N925-082, which weighs 19g, this hallmark is your legal assurance that the metal has been verified by a third-party authority.

4. Is this bracelet hypoallergenic for sensitive skin?
Sterling silver is generally considered safe for most skin types. Our 925 silver is nickel-compliant, meeting EU and UK REACH regulations. Because it is high-purity silver alloyed with copper, it lacks the common irritants found in cheaper base-metal jewellery, making it an excellent choice for daily contact with the skin.

Care & Maintenance
13. Why does silver tarnish and how do I prevent it?
Tarnish is a natural chemical reaction between silver and sulphur in the air. To minimize this, store the bracelet in an airtight pouch when not in use. Regular wear actually helps prevent tarnish, as the friction against your skin and clothing naturally "polishes" the surface before oxidation can take hold.
14. Is it safe to wear this bracelet in the shower?
While water won't hurt the silver, soaps and shampoos can leave a "scum" film in the crevices of the links, dulling the shine. Furthermore, chlorinated pool water or salt water can accelerate oxidation. We recommend removing the bracelet before swimming or heavy cleaning to maintain its pristine condition.
15. How should I clean the N925-082 at home?
Use a dual-action silver polishing cloth. The inner treated layer removes tarnish chemically, while the outer layer buffs the metal to a high shine. Avoid "dip" cleaners for link bracelets, as the chemicals can get trapped inside the link joints and cause long-term corrosion.
16. Does this bracelet require professional servicing?
We recommend a professional ultrasonic clean once a year. This process uses high-frequency sound waves to remove deep-seated dirt and skin oils from the link pivots that a cloth cannot reach, ensuring the links continue to move smoothly without abrasive wear.
